## CI Troubleshooting: Stale Cache in Plugin Builds

Following the Fernwick stale-cache incident, the Loomhaven CI runners now key plugin caches on a combined hash of the lockfile and the plugin manifest version. If your plugin picks up outdated dependencies, confirm you bumped the manifest version — a lockfile-only change no longer invalidates the cache by itself. Clearing caches manually is rarely needed and should be a last resort. When filing a report, include the trace token printed below your build summary.

trace token, fawig-fawef: htk3_0ee

## Formula sandbox tuning

User-supplied formulas in Gridmoor execute inside a restricted interpreter with hard ceilings on time, memory, and call depth. Reviewers should confirm any change to these ceilings is justified in the PR description, since raising them widens the abuse surface. Defaults were chosen from production traces. The current limits are as follows.

limits module of tafog-fawip:
WEIGHTS = {
    "julix": 57,
    "lamys": 992,
    "kasvan": 209,
    "quenok": 750,
    "alddor": 259,
    "oliath": 1009,
    "wenix": 815,
}

**Q: Why do converted amounts in Ledgewise sometimes differ by a cent?** Rounding happens per line item, not per invoice total, so sums can drift. This is intentional; do not "fix" it by rounding the total. If you must regenerate the reconciliation keystore after a schema change, unlock it with the recovery passphrase given below.

strongbox words: eliius-pelath-sorius-oliys-noviel